Heidi J

I first met Chris at the Prairie Nightmare Backyard Ultra in August 2023. During that race, we chatted about different training runs, and I learned that he was a coach. Shortly after, I started following him and discovered his coaching business, Ultra Addiction. I was already considering getting a coach to enhance my training, and the timing felt right.

In April 2024, I began working with Chris after dealing with a posterior tibial tendinitis injury in my right ankle and foot. At that point, I wasn’t sure how to safely return to running, let alone compete again. Chris not only helped me rehab from the injury but also guided me through a structured training plan that prepared me for the Saskatchewan Marathon at the end of May. His expertise and personalized approach led to a new personal best—something I hadn’t thought possible just months before.

Even though my coaching is remote, Chris’s structured workouts sync effortlessly with my Garmin, and he’s always able to adjust the plan based on my data. Throughout the summer, Chris continued to coach me as I prepared for both Beaver Flat 50 and my primary race, the 100 km Iron Horse Ultra. Every run had a purpose, and under his guidance, I started to feel like a true athlete. He kept me focused and motivated while ensuring I stayed injury-free.

At the Iron Horse Ultra, Chris was an incredible support. He met me at every aid station, offering encouragement and valuable advice. I achieved a new PB beating my pervious time by over an hour. His calm demeanor and focus on helping his clients achieve their personal best are qualities I deeply appreciate in a coach. No matter the race or the goal, Chris creates an environment where you feel supported and understood.

Working with Chris has been a game-changer for my running journey. I can’t recommend him enough to anyone looking to elevate their performance. My only regret is not working with him sooner—don’t wait until you need injury rehab to add him to your team!
